Unsubscribe Users From CleverTap E-Mails

Step 1: Make your CSV file

Open Excel or Google Sheets.

Create a CSV file with two columns: identity,MSG-email (all lowercase).

Add each user’s unique identity in the first column, and write false in the second column to mark them as unsubscribed.

Step 2: Go to CleverTap

Log in to CleverTap. From the left menu, go to Settings → Engage → CSV Uploads.

Click + Upload, then choose Upload user profiles.

Select your CSV file and click Save & Upload.

Step 3: Upload your CSV

After uploading, click Map next to your file.

Map identity → identity (this links to the user’s unique ID).

Map MSG-email → User Property and select True or False as the data type.

If MSG-email isn’t listed, choose “Same as column name” to create it.

Then click Process File to start the upload.

Step 4: Check your upload

Once processing is complete, go to Segments → Find People.

Search for one of the users from your CSV by their identity.

Open their profile and scroll to User Properties.

You should now see MSG-email = false listed, this means the user has been unsubscribed.
